Context Readings

Jesus Is Mocked

29 and plaited a crown of thorns and put upon his head, and a reed in his right hand. And bowed their knees before him, and mocked him, saying, "Hail, King of the Jews," 30 and spitted upon him, and took the reed and smote him on the head. 31 And when they had mocked him, they took the robe off him again, and put his own raiment on him, and led him away to crucify him.
